Description

[Supplementary data files to "Highly Accurate Potential Energy Surface and Dipole Moment Surface for Nitrous Oxide and Ames-296K Infrared Line Lists for 14N216O and Minor Isotopologues"]

First generation of Ames-296K Infrared line lists computed for each of 12 N2O isotopologues of 14/15N and 16/17/18O in the full range of 0 – 15,000 cm-1, with E' up to 20,000 cm-1and intensity cutoff 1 x 10-31 cm-1/molecule.cm-2 at room temperature (296 K), computed using Ames-1 PES (refined) and DMS. Each line list contains 1.3 – 1.6 million transitions. A 'natural' N2O line list includes 3.19 million lines from all N2O isotopologues with intensities scaled by their terrestrial abundances. Compared to HITRAN, HITEMP, NOSL-296, and recent high-resolution experiments. the line lists provide much more complete coverage, plus more reliable and more consistent predictions for those bands missing from current databases, e.g., weaker bands, high energy bands, or minor isotopologue bands. These line lists will enable the N2O IR spectral analysis and opacity simulation required to enhance the scientific return from astronomical observations, and facilitate the chracterization of astrophysics environments containing N2O, which is one of the important potential biosignature molecules in the atmosphere of those exoplanets that reside in habitable zones. These are the first-generation, highly accurate IR line lists generated from studies funded by NASA Grant 18-APRA18-0013 through NASA/SETI Institute Co-operative Agreement 80NSSC20K1358. N2O_12_iso_J0-150_levels_based_on_Ames-1.PES.zip J=0-150 rovibrational energy levels of 12 N2O isotopologues of 14/15N and 16/17/18O, computed on Ames-1 PES. Up to 15,000 cm-1 or 19,500 cm-1 above zero-point energy. 169.68 MB May 11, 2023
n2o.natural.296K.Ames-1.12iso.J150.1E-31.dat Ames-296K "natural" N2O IR line list including all 12 isotopologues of 14/15N and 16/17/18O with terrestrial abundances. Ames-1 PES and DMS based. 353.3 MB May 11, 2023
N2O_12_iso_Ames-296K_IR_line_lists.zip Ames-296K IR line lists for each of 12 N2O isotopologues of 14/15N and 16/17/18O in the range of 0 - 15,000 cm-1, with J=0-150, intensity cut off at 1E-31 cm/molecule. Based on Ames-1 PES and DMS for N2O. 592.72 MB May 11, 2023
